I'm not expert for this but as can see:
- on transmiter side is ST50 which have TTL(UART) output
- on receiver side is USB port
That mean you need UART to USB converter between this two parts.
You have USB to 485 converter, which is different protocol.
Solution is use UART/USB adapter which is very cheap and just connect red from ST50 to RX, and blue to GND.
Then set baud rate and other and that is must work.
